nbc sports: CLEVELAND - LeBron James and his new teammates didn’t need any time getting acquainted.
James scored 25 points and had 11 assists while all four players acquired in Thursday’s blockbuster trade contributed, leading the Cleveland Cavaliers past Memphis 109-89 Sunday night.
As debuts go, these new-look Cavaliers were a smashing success. Cleveland built a 28-point lead midway through the second quarter and coasted to victory.
